Description
Short-shorts bedecked Lt. Dangle and company head to Miami for the American Police Convention. No sooner can you say "bio-terrorism" than the hotel is quarantined. The Wahoe County's hapless misfits get shut out when their credentials can't be found. But the crew must step in and save the city from "complete chaos." Complete chaos ensues. The cops, with an early "814" call that does not, as the officers believe, decode as armed intruder, but actually involves a loose chicken. The crew encounter a taunting good ol' boy who, when faced with an alligator in a swimming pool, boldly goes where officers Jones and Garcia fear to tread.
